What constitutes a Registered Agent?

A registered agent is a designated entity charged with accepting legal documents and important communications on behalf of a company. This encompasses items like service of process notices, government communications, and compliance-related documents. The registered agent acts as a point of contact between the business and the government, ensuring that essential data is delivered in a timely manner.

Companies, including LLCs and corporate entities, are legally required to appoint a designated agent in the jurisdiction in which they are incorporated. This obligation helps ensure transparency and adherence with legal requirements. The designated agent must have a physical address in the state and be present during standard business hours to accept documents.

Numerous entrepreneurs opt to engage a professional registered agent service to perform this role. These services offer knowledge in regulatory affairs, help handle crucial deadlines, and offer an added layer of confidentiality by keeping sensitive data off public records. By utilizing a registered agent service, companies can ensure that they meet legal obligations and safeguard their interests efficiently.

Value of a Designated Agent

A designated agent serves as a vital link between a enterprise and the jurisdiction in which it operates. This appointed person or organization receives important legal documents and government correspondence on behalf of the company, ensuring that important information is communicated promptly. Without a registered agent, a company may miss crucial deadlines or fail to respond to legal matters, leading to repercussions or loss of reputation.

Having a registered agent also supports conformity with regulatory requirements. Different states have distinct laws governing the responsibilities of official agents, which include maintaining a registered office site and being accessible during business hours. By hiring a reliable registered agent service, companies can have peace of mind that they are meeting these standards and can focus on their primary operations without worrying about legal issues.

Moreover, utilizing a registered agent can enhance privacy for company owners. By listing a registered agent’s address instead of private addresses in public records, firm owners can keep their personal information hidden. This is particularly advantageous for independent company owners and startups who wish to maintain a level of privacy while fulfilling their legal requirements efficiently.

Costs and Pricing of Official Agent Services

When assessing the pricing related to designated agent services, it is crucial to understand that pricing differs greatly based on the provider and the level of service offered. Typically, the typical cost for a business registered agent can fall from $50 to $300 per year. This entails basic services such as accepting legal documents and governmental correspondence on behalf of the enterprise. However, more comprehensive services, including regulatory tracking and document management, can lead to greater fees.

For those looking for affordable registered agent service, there are plenty of options available, often with fair pricing. Some providers offer low-cost registered agent services starting as low as $15 to $25 per year. These cost-effective choices may provide only the necessary services, so it is necessary for company owners to understand what is provided before making a decision. Comparing different registered agent service firms can help find the best solution based on both quality of service and cost.

Agent of Record Legislative Obligations

All commercial entity, including LLCs and corporate entities, have to select a statutory agent through its establishment procedure. In many regions, the designated representative has to be an person resident of the region or a company authorized to do business in that jurisdiction. A few regions enable businesses to act as their internal statutory agent, but this is not always advisable. Utilizing a specialized registered agent service can aid alleviate the burden of maintaining adherence with the regulatory criteria, as these providers are experienced in managing the complexities of various local laws.

Additionally, businesses are required to maintain their statutory agent information accurate with regulatory bodies. Omission to maintain up-to-date information can result in sanctions or loss of compliance status. Hiring a reliable registered agent service assists verify that these regulatory obligations are regularly fulfilled, supporting the long-term interests of the company.
